Redetermination of the Decay Energy ofBa133

Abstract
We have redetermined the L1K electron capture ratio for the decay of Ba133 to the 437-keV level of Cs133 using a modified version of the sum-coincidence technique. The L and K x-ray intensities following electron capture were measured in coincidence with the 437-keV sum peak arising from the coincidence summing of the 356-81-keV γ cascade in Cs133. The measured L1K ratio of 0.67±0.15 leads to a decay energy of 623.7+6.8 keV to the 437-keV level. This value is closer to the recent determination of Schulz than to the earlier ones.
